Before rooting Innjoo:

  • Backup your device to PC.
  • Enable unknown sources in security settings.
  • Enable USB debugging in developer options.

ROOT Innjoo WITH PC:root Innjoo

This method is for advanced users and it requires technical skill. It involves high amount of risks. Proceed only if you are familiar with the technical steps used in this method.

  • Download SP flash tool and extract it to your PC.
  • Download SuperSU.zip and copy to root directory of your device internal memory or sd card.
  • Download and install VCom drivers for PC from HERE.
  • Download Innjoo recovey image developed by team Hovatek compatible for your device.

Switch off your device and connect to PC. Open SP flash tool and select the recovery button in the tool. Select the Innjoo recovery image and click on download. It will flash recovery on your device. You will see a green check mark as pop up once the tool successfully flashes the recovery image. Disconnect the phone from PC and reboot your device into recovery by pressing power and volume up button. Once your device is in recovery mode install the SuperSu.zip file. Wipe dalvik cache after installing the SuperSU.zip to avoid boot loop. Reboot normally and you are done. Your device is successfully rooted.

Check for the compatible recovery image developed by Hovatek team in their forum. Flashing inappropriate file will brick your device. Ensure that you have the correct files.
